Invest 0.2 million/200 thousand to buy a fund with an annual interest rate of 6% and save it for 5 years. How much can I get in the end? Should not be a simple 200,000 * 6% * 5+200,000 = 260,000?
If it is a compound interest calculation, it is the compound interest final value formula: f = p (1+I) n.
F is the final value, p is the present value, n is the number of periods, and I is the interest rate.
F=20( 1+6%)^5
Check the final compound interest coefficient table (1+6%)= 1.3382.
